The Importance of SEO in Digital Marketing

Mastering SEO: A Comprehensive Guide to Boosting Your Website’s Visibility

Introduction

In the digital age, where millions of websites compete for attention, Search Engine Optimization (SEO) has become an essential strategy for businesses and content creators. SEO is the art and science of enhancing a website’s visibility on search engines like Google, Bing, and Yahoo. The ultimate goal is to increase the quantity and quality of organic traffic to a website. This comprehensive guide will delve into the intricacies of SEO, offering a detailed roadmap to help you master the essentials and apply best practices to boost your site’s visibility and performance.

1. Understanding SEO

Definition and Goals

SEO, or Search Engine Optimization, is the process of optimizing a website to rank higher in search engine results pages (SERPs). The primary goal of SEO is to improve a site’s visibility so that it appears on the first page of search results when users search for relevant keywords or phrases. This increased visibility leads to higher traffic and potential conversions.

Objectives of SEO:

  • Increase Visibility: Ensure your website appears prominently in search engine results for relevant queries.
  • Drive Traffic: Attract a steady stream of visitors to your site from organic search results.
  • Enhance User Experience: Improve site usability, speed, and content relevance to provide a better experience for users.

How Search Engines Work

To understand SEO, it’s crucial to grasp how search engines operate. Search engines use complex algorithms to index and rank web pages based on relevance and quality. The key components of this process include:

  • Crawling: Search engines use bots or crawlers to explore and index web pages. These bots follow links from one page to another, gathering information about each page they visit.
  • Indexing: After crawling, search engines store and organize the information in an index. The index is a massive database that contains the content and metadata of billions of web pages.
  • Ranking: When a user performs a search, the search engine’s algorithm analyzes the indexed pages to determine which ones are most relevant to the query. The algorithm considers various factors, including keywords, content quality, site structure, and user experience, to rank the pages.

2. Key Components of SEO

Basic SEO

Crawling and Indexing

For effective SEO, it’s essential to ensure that search engines can crawl and index your website properly. Here are some best practices:

  • Create a Sitemap: A sitemap is a file that lists all the pages on your website, helping search engines discover and index them. Submit your sitemap to search engines via tools like Google Search Console.
  • Use Robots.txt: The robots.txt file instructs search engine bots on which pages or sections of your site to crawl or avoid. Ensure this file is configured correctly to prevent blocking important pages.

Keyword Research

Keyword research involves identifying the terms and phrases your target audience uses to search for information related to your business. Effective keyword research is the foundation of SEO and includes:

  • Identifying Keywords: Use tools like Google Keyword Planner, SEMrush, or Ahrefs to find relevant keywords with high search volume and low competition.
  • Long-Tail Keywords: Focus on long-tail keywords, which are longer and more specific phrases that attract highly targeted traffic.

On-Page Optimization

On-page optimisation refers to optimizing individual web pages to rank higher and attract more relevant traffic. Key elements include:

  • Title Tags: The title tag appears in search results and browser tabs. Include your primary keyword and ensure it is compelling and relevant.
  • Meta Descriptions: The meta description provides a brief summary of the page’s content. Write a clear, engaging description that includes keywords and encourages users to click through.
  • Header Tags: Use header tags (H1, H2, H3) to structure your content and make it easier for both users and search engines to understand.

Technical SEO

Site Architecture

A well-organized site structure helps search engines crawl and index your content efficiently. Consider the following:

  • URL Structure: Use descriptive, keyword-rich URLs that reflect the content of the page. Avoid long and complex URLs.
  • Internal Linking: Create a clear hierarchy with internal links that connect related pages, helping users and search engines navigate your site.

Mobile Optimization

With the increasing use of mobile devices, optimizing your site for mobile users is crucial:

  • Responsive Design: Ensure your website adapts to different screen sizes and devices, providing a seamless experience for mobile users.
  • Mobile-Friendly Test: Use tools like Google’s Mobile-Friendly Test to check how well your site performs on mobile devices.

Page Speed

Page speed is a critical factor in user experience and SEO. Faster loading times lead to lower bounce rates and higher engagement. Improve page speed by:

  • Optimizing Images: Compress images to reduce file size without sacrificing quality.
  • Minimizing Code: Minify CSS, JavaScript, and HTML to reduce the size of your web pages.
  • Using Caching: Implement browser caching to speed up page load times for returning visitors.

Content

Quality Content

Content is a central element of SEO, and creating high-quality content is essential for attracting and retaining visitors:

  • Relevance: Ensure your content is relevant to your target audience and addresses their needs and interests.
  • Engagement: Write engaging and well-structured content that keeps users on your site and encourages them to explore further.
  • Originality: Avoid duplicate content and provide unique insights or perspectives that differentiate your site from competitors.

Content Formatting

Proper content formatting enhances readability and user experience:

  • Headings and Subheadings: Use headings and subheadings to break up content and make it easier to scan.
  • Bulleted Lists: Organize information into bulleted lists to improve readability.
  • Multimedia: Incorporate images, videos, and infographics to make your content more engaging.

Links

Internal Links

Internal linking helps users navigate your site and improves SEO by distributing link equity:

  • Relevance: Link to related content within your site to provide additional value and context.
  • Anchor Text: Use descriptive anchor text that indicates the content of the linked page.

External Links

Earning high-quality backlinks from authoritative sites boosts your site’s credibility and ranking:

  • Guest Blogging: Write guest posts for reputable sites in your industry to build backlinks.
  • Content Promotion: Promote your content through social media and outreach to earn natural backlinks.

3. SEO Strategies

Keyword Research and Optimization

Effective keyword research and optimization are crucial for targeting the right audience and improving search rankings:

  • Keyword Discovery: Use keyword research tools to identify terms and phrases relevant to your business.
  • Keyword Placement: Incorporate keywords naturally into your content, including title tags, headings, and body text.
  • Content Optimization: Regularly update and optimize content to reflect changing trends and search behaviors.

On-Page SEO

On-page SEO involves optimizing individual pages to improve their relevance and performance:

  • Title Tags and Meta Descriptions: Craft compelling and keyword-rich title tags and meta descriptions to attract clicks and improve rankings.
  • Header Tags: Use header tags to structure your content and enhance its relevance to search queries.
  • Image Alt Text: Provide descriptive alt text for images to improve accessibility and help search engines understand the content.

Technical SEO Enhancements

Technical SEO focuses on the underlying aspects of your site that impact its performance and visibility:

  • Site Speed Optimization: Implement strategies to improve loading times and enhance user experience.
  • Mobile Optimization: Ensure your site is fully responsive and performs well on mobile devices.
  • XML Sitemap: Create and submit an XML sitemap to help search engines crawl and index your site more effectively.

Content Marketing

Content marketing involves creating and distributing valuable content to attract and engage your target audience:

  • Content Creation: Develop high-quality, relevant content that addresses your audience’s needs and interests.
  • Content Distribution: Promote your content through various channels, including social media, email marketing, and industry forums.
  • Content Refresh: Regularly update and refresh existing content to maintain its relevance and accuracy.

Link Building

Link building is the process of acquiring backlinks from other sites to boost your site’s authority and rankings:

  • Quality Backlinks: Focus on earning backlinks from reputable and authoritative sites in your industry.
  • Internal Linking: Use internal links to guide users to related content and enhance site navigation.
  • Link Acquisition Strategies: Implement strategies such as guest blogging, content promotion, and outreach to build a strong backlink profile.

Local SEO

Local SEO focuses on optimizing your site for local search queries and attracting nearby customers:

  • Google My Business: Create and optimize a Google My Business listing to improve local visibility and attract local customers.
  • Local Keywords: Incorporate location-based keywords into your content to target local search queries.
  • Local Listings: Ensure your business is listed in local directories and review sites to enhance local search visibility.

4. Monitoring and Analyzing SEO Performance

Tracking Tools

Monitoring and analyzing SEO performance is essential for measuring success and identifying areas for improvement:

  • Google Analytics: Use Google Analytics to track traffic, user behavior, and other key metrics.
  • Google Search Console: Monitor your site’s performance in search results, including impressions, clicks, and average rankings.

Key Metrics

Track and analyze the following metrics to evaluate your SEO efforts:

  • Organic Traffic: Measure the number of visitors coming to your site from search engines.
  • Bounce Rate: Analyze the percentage of visitors who leave your site after viewing only one page.
  • Conversion Rate: Track the percentage of visitors who complete desired actions, such as making a purchase or filling out a contact form.
  • Keyword Rankings: Monitor your site’s rankings for target keywords and track changes over time.

Adjusting Strategies

Use insights from performance data to make data-driven adjustments to your SEO strategies:

  • Identify Trends: Look for trends and patterns in your data to understand what’s working and what needs improvement.
  • Optimize Content: Update and optimize content based on performance data and user feedback.
  • Refine Keyword Strategy: Adjust your keyword strategy based on changes in search trends and competition.

5. Community Insights and Trends

Staying Updated

Keeping up with industry news and trends is crucial for staying competitive and adapting to changes in search algorithms:

  • Industry News: Follow reputable SEO blogs and news sites to stay informed about the latest updates and best practices.
  • Algorithm Updates: Monitor search engine algorithm updates to understand how changes may impact your site’s performance.

Engaging with SEO Communities

Participating in SEO communities provides valuable insights and opportunities for learning and networking:

  • Reddit’s r/SEO: Engage with the SEO community on Reddit’s r/SEO to discuss strategies, share experiences, and seek advice from industry professionals.
  • Forums and Groups: Join SEO forums and social media groups to connect with others in the industry and stay updated on trends and best practices.

6. Conclusion

Mastering SEO is an ongoing process that requires a deep understanding of search engine algorithms, effective strategies, and continuous optimization. By focusing on key components such as keyword research, on-page optimization, technical SEO, content marketing, and link building, you can improve your website’s visibility, drive more traffic, and enhance user experience. Regularly monitoring performance and staying updated with industry trends will help you adapt and refine your SEO efforts to achieve long-term success.

Call to Action

Ready to boost your website’s visibility and drive more organic traffic? Start by implementing the SEO strategies outlined in this guide and continuously optimize your efforts based on performance data and industry trends. For further assistance, consider consulting with SEO experts or accessing additional resources to enhance your SEO knowledge and skills.

Get In Touch Today

We can make your business grow